In the super-G and downhill, Chemmy Alcott was a rare female competitor in a historically male-dominated GB team.
Alcott impressed as she finished 11th in the women's downhill, but was disqualified from the combined due to a technical infringement with the width of her skis.

The men's short track speed skating team was Jon Eley and Paul Stanley.
This was the first Olympics in which Great Britain and Northern Ireland sent a full short track speed skating team.
First-time Olympian Zoe Gillings was the sole British competitor in the snowboardcross event which had its first Olympic appearance in 2006.
